Mom Runs Over 7-Year-Old Son With Her Car After Making Him Walk From School As A Form Of Punishment

Aiexpress  –  An Alabama mother punished her 7-year-old son by forcing him to walk home from school and then running him over by accident. According to police,

Sarai Rachel James, 27, picked up her son from school in Boaz about 3:30 p.m. on February 9 and learned from the administrator that he had been in trouble at school that morning, according to police.

According to authorities, James stopped her car near the school and forced her kid to get out. According to the cops, she informed him he’d have to walk or run the other eight blocks home.

James drove beside her son for a few streets, but as she slowed down, the child attempted to grab the car’s door handle, Boaz Chief of Police Michael Abercrombie, told McClatchy News.

According to authorities, she accelerated, and her kid was dragged below the car, which ran over him with its rear wheel.

According to Abercrombie, police believe James ran over the youngster by accident, but he would never have been there if she had not chosen to punish him.

“She might not have realized he was doing that,” Abercrombie explained.

He was brought to the University of Alabama hospital with merely abrasions on his back and side of the head.

Abercombie stated, “God watched over him.”

James, 27 years old, was arrested and charged with serious child abuse. She was released on a $50,000 bond three days later, according to jail records.

James is prohibited from contacting her kid, according to Al.com.

Another 53-year-old woman in the vehicle at the time of the incident was charged with a misdemeanor: endangering the welfare of a child. She was released on $500 bail.
